Posted By: <b>Pete Z.</b><p>There's a group of n43s at a card shop and all have scrapbook removal damage to the backs. Several of them are stamped Metropolitan Museum New York, which I take to mean the Metropolitan Museum of Art, duplicate, with initials. I'm figuring this was in the Burdick collection and released at some time because it was a duplicate. Does this make sense or does anybody have any other thoughts?<br /><br />Thanks,<br />Pete<br /><br /><img src="http://www.myfilehut.com/public/17554/DSCN0052.JPG">
